Wesla Whitfield
Wesla Whitfield is a celebrated jazz vocalist known for her rich, contralto tone and sophisticated interpretations of the Great American Songbook. Her discography reflects a deep commitment to traditional jazz standards, often featuring collaborations with prominent instrumentalists and arrangements that highlight her distinctive phrasing. Whitfield's recordings, including works such as 'September Songs: Music Of Wilder Weill & Warren,' demonstrate her ability to navigate complex harmonies and emotional depth within the genre. She has maintained a steady presence in the jazz community, delivering performances that balance classic elegance with contemporary sensibility. Her body of work serves as a testament to the enduring power of vocal jazz, offering listeners a refined exploration of timeless compositions through her unique artistic lens.
